Om's operating thesis is that the amount of discipline you need to show up to a pursuit is inversely proportional to how aligned it is with your genuine interest. If something demands daily willpower, it's likely the wrong pursuit — and you'll never reach the top percentile in it. His whole life has been interest-driven: the more curious he was, the better he performed, with discipline reserved only for routines like health and sleep.
